How to Build a Following, Make Authentic Connections, and Promote Your WorkWhether you’re an artist or craftsman selling your work, the owner of a small start-up hoping to network, or just looking for a more meaningful social media experience, this is the book for you. Brainard Carey draws from his experience and interviews with others to show creative people how to make the most of their time on outlets like Twitter, Facebook, and Instagram. Readers will learn how to develop social media campaigns that reflect their personalities, share their unique offerings, and achieve their goals. Chapter topics include: Building a followingMaintaining an authentic imageCreative ways to share informationUsing social media to earn a livingAnd much moreWith chapters focusing on practical how-tos and real-world examples, Succeed with Social Media Like a Creative Genius™ provides readers with both instructive and demonstrative lessons in making the most of their online presence. Everyone can do it with the right tools, and Carey offers an insider's guide to an otherwise daunting process. This book will awaken and nurture the creative genius in everyone.

How today’s artists survive, exhibit, and earn money—without selling out! Career-minded artists, this is the book you have been waiting for! Making It in the Art World, Second Edition, explains how to be a professional artist and shares new methods to define and realize what success means. Whether you’re a beginner, a student, or a career artist looking to be in the best museum shows, this book provides ways of advancing your plans on any level. Author Brainard Carey, an artist himself with prestigious exhibitions like the Whitney Biennial under his belt, draws on more than twenty years of experience in the art world and from over 1,500 interviews with artists and curators for Yale University Radio. Included is a thirteen-part workbook to help you formulate and execute a winning career advancement strategy, a process that will prepare you for navigating the art world successfully. Friendly chapters walk you through it all with topics such as: Evaluating your workSubmitting proposals to museums and galleriesCreating pop-up showsPresenting work to the publicDoing it your way (DIY exhibits) Organizing eventsWriting press releasesFinding collectors online and connectingUsing social media effectivelySelling onlineRaising funds for projectsGetting international recognitionMaking It in the Art World, Second Edition, is an invaluable resource for artists at every stage, offering readers a plethora of strategies and helpful tips to plan and execute a successful artistic career.

Learn how to navigate the often turbulent seas of the art world from prestigious artist Brainard Carey.In this succinct volume, Author Brainard Carey, an artist himself with prestigious exhibitions like the Whitney Biennial under his belt, draws on more than twenty years of experience in the art world and distills 1,900 interviews from Yale University radio of artists and curators that explain how they manage and maintain their art careers.In The Problem with the Art World: An Artist’s A-Z Navigation Guide, Carey will cover:-The Artist Statement (how to write it)-Grants (how to get them)-Gallery Exhibitions (how to approach a gallery)-Museum Exhibitions (how to approach a museum)-Alternative Spaces (finding and applying)-Residencies (how to apply and why)And much more! The Problem with the Art World is an A-Z guide on the best path to take and the best choices to make in the unpredictable art world.The art world as the press talks about it is a very small slice of artists who working in a particular way, and most artists don’t fit in to that definition. Because of that, there is confusion and artists tend to feel like they are on the outside looking in at a rigged system of which they are victims. But that is simply not the case. For the busy artist, this book contains your cheat-notes on how to get shows, sales, and build a support system for your art. There are multiple art worlds and to think that the artist is being sidelined by one is inaccurate. The artist should focus on their art, as they are visionaries, and that is all that matters. The Problem with the Art World will give you the ability to do that.
